Title: Can you draw this picture?
Post by: jbertonbounds on October 01, 2014, 05:09:14 PM
Anna: [Doing homework] "Daddy, I've got to draw this spelling word, and I don't know how."
Me: "Well, let me see."
Anna: "The word is 'beget.' "
Me: [LOL] "What?!"
Anna: "Well I'm glad nothing came up when I searched on Google Images."
Me: [LOL] "Me too!"

I remember these  , they are kind of old  , but still cute things kids say  and think   


JAMES (age 4)**
was listening to a Bible story. His dad read: 'The man named Lot was

warned to take his wife and flee out of the city but his wife looked back

and was turned to salt. Concerned, James asked: 'What happened to the flea?'

:laugh:

The Sermon I think this Mom will never forget **

This particular Sunday sermon.....'Dear Lord,' the minister began, with

arms extended toward heaven and a rapturous look on his upturned face.

'Without you, we are but dust...' He would have continued but at that

moment my very obedient daughter who was listening leaned over to me and

asked quite audibly in her shrill little four year old girl voice, 'Mom, what is butt dust?'
